separate (GPR)
package body Stamps is
-----------------------
-- Local Subprograms --
-----------------------
function V (T : Time_Stamp_Type; X : Time_Stamp_Index) return Nat;
-- Extract two decimal digit value from time stamp
---------
-- "<" --
---------
function "<" (Left, Right : Time_Stamp_Type) return Boolean is
begin
return not (Left = Right) and then String (Left) < String (Right);
end "<";
----------
-- "<=" --
----------
function "<=" (Left, Right : Time_Stamp_Type) return Boolean is
begin
return not (Left > Right);
end "<=";
---------
-- "=" --
---------
function "=" (Left, Right : Time_Stamp_Type) return Boolean is
Sleft : Nat;
Sright : Nat;
begin
if String (Left) = String (Right) then
return True;
elsif Left (1) = ' ' or else Right (1) = ' ' then
return False;
end if;
-- In the following code we check for a difference of 2 seconds or less
-- Recall that the time stamp format is:
-- Y Y Y Y M M D D H H M M S S
-- 01 02 03 04 05 06 07 08 09 10 11 12 13 14
-- Note that we do not bother to worry about shifts in the day.
-- It seems unlikely that such shifts could ever occur in practice
-- and even if they do we err on the safe side, i.e., we say that the
-- time stamps are different.
Sright := V (Right, 13) + 60 * (V (Right, 11) + 60 * V (Right, 09));
Sleft := V (Left, 13) + 60 * (V (Left, 11) + 60 * V (Left, 09));
-- So the check is: dates must be the same, times differ 2 sec at most
return abs (Sleft - Sright) <= 2
and then String (Left (1 .. 8)) = String (Right (1 .. 8));
end "=";
---------
-- ">" --
---------
function ">" (Left, Right : Time_Stamp_Type) return Boolean is
begin
return not (Left = Right) and then String (Left) > String (Right);
end ">";
----------
-- ">=" --
----------
function ">=" (Left, Right : Time_Stamp_Type) return Boolean is
begin
return not (Left < Right);
end ">=";
-------
-- V --
-------
function V (T : Time_Stamp_Type; X : Time_Stamp_Index) return Nat is
begin
return 10 * (Character'Pos (T (X)) - Character'Pos ('0')) +
Character'Pos (T (X + 1)) - Character'Pos ('0');
end V;
end Stamps;
